From 0eb327fc2e1902bae76ff09d790fbb7d6ebc4f46 Mon Sep 17 00:00:00 2001
From: RuoYi <yzz_ivy@163.com>
Date: 星期四, 01 十二月 2022 16:13:14 +0800
Subject: [PATCH] 升级oshi到最新版本6.3.2
---
src/main/resources/vm/vue/v3/index-tree.vue.vm | 39 +++++++++++++--------------------------
1 files changed, 13 insertions(+), 26 deletions(-)
diff --git a/src/main/resources/vm/vue/v3/index-tree.vue.vm b/src/main/resources/vm/vue/v3/index-tree.vue.vm
index e16a119..de507db 100644
--- a/src/main/resources/vm/vue/v3/index-tree.vue.vm
+++ b/src/main/resources/vm/vue/v3/index-tree.vue.vm
@@ -136,24 +136,9 @@
#end
<el-table-column label="鎿嶄綔" align="center" class-name="small-padding fixed-width">
<template #default="scope">
- <el-button
- type="text"
- icon="Edit"
- @click="handleUpdate(scope.row)"
- v-hasPermi="['${moduleName}:${businessName}:edit']"
- >淇敼</el-button>
- <el-button
- type="text"
- icon="Plus"
- @click="handleAdd(scope.row)"
- v-hasPermi="['${moduleName}:${businessName}:add']"
- >鏂板</el-button>
- <el-button
- type="text"
- icon="Delete"
- @click="handleDelete(scope.row)"
- v-hasPermi="['${moduleName}:${businessName}:remove']"
- >鍒犻櫎</el-button>
+ <el-button link type="primary" icon="Edit" @click="handleUpdate(scope.row)" v-hasPermi="['${moduleName}:${businessName}:edit']">淇敼</el-button>
+ <el-button link type="primary" icon="Plus" @click="handleAdd(scope.row)" v-hasPermi="['${moduleName}:${businessName}:add']">鏂板</el-button>
+ <el-button link type="primary" icon="Delete" @click="handleDelete(scope.row)" v-hasPermi="['${moduleName}:${businessName}:remove']">鍒犻櫎</el-button>
</template>
</el-table-column>
</el-table>
@@ -174,11 +159,13 @@
#set($dictType=$column.dictType)
#if("" != $treeParentCode && $column.javaField == $treeParentCode)
<el-form-item label="${comment}" prop="${treeParentCode}">
- <tree-select
- v-model:value="form.${treeParentCode}"
- :options="${businessName}Options"
- :objMap="{ value: '${treeCode}', label: '${treeName}', children: 'children' }"
+ <el-tree-select
+ v-model="form.${treeParentCode}"
+ :data="${businessName}Options"
+ :props="{ value: '${treeCode}', label: '${treeName}', children: 'children' }"
+ value-key="${treeCode}"
placeholder="璇烽�夋嫨${comment}"
+ check-strictly
/>
</el-form-item>
#elseif($column.htmlType == "input")
@@ -354,8 +341,8 @@
}
/** 鏌ヨ${functionName}涓嬫媺鏍戠粨鏋� */
-async function getTreeselect() {
- await list${BusinessName}().then(response => {
+function getTreeselect() {
+ list${BusinessName}().then(response => {
${businessName}Options.value = [];
const data = { ${treeCode}: 0, ${treeName}: '椤剁骇鑺傜偣', children: [] };
data.children = proxy.handleTree(response.data, "${treeCode}", "${treeParentCode}");
@@ -404,9 +391,9 @@
}
/** 鏂板鎸夐挳鎿嶄綔 */
-async function handleAdd(row) {
+function handleAdd(row) {
reset();
- await getTreeselect();
+ getTreeselect();
if (row != null && row.${treeCode}) {
form.value.${treeParentCode} = row.${treeCode};
} else {
--
Gitblit v1.9.3